A Parliamentary delegation from India, led by the Hon’ble Deputy Chairman of the Rajya Sabha, Shri Harivansh Narayan Singh, was warmly received in Almaty by Mr. Zakirzhan Kuziyev, Member of the Senate of Kazakhstan. The high-level meeting featured constructive and forward-looking discussions focused on enhancing bilateral Parliamentary cooperation between India and Kazakhstan.
This significant engagement marked another step forward in deepening the longstanding friendship and institutional ties shared by India and Kazakhstan. Both sides reiterated their commitment to fostering mutual understanding and strengthening the framework of inter-parliamentary dialogue.
During their stay in Almaty, the Indian delegation paid homage at the statue of Mahatma Gandhi, reflecting on the enduring legacy of the Mahatma and the shared values of peace, non-violence, and mutual respect that continue to guide India-Kazakhstan relations.
To honour the visiting Parliamentary delegation, Ambassador Dr. T. V. Nagendra Prasad hosted a special reception. The event witnessed enthusiastic participation from members of the Indian community in Almaty and featured engaging conversations on India’s vibrant democratic traditions, parliamentary functioning, and the ever-growing people-to-people connections between the two nations.
